Where You’ll Work

Founded in 1961, Dignity Health - Arroyo Grande Community Hospital is a 65-bed, acute care, nonprofit hospital located in Arroyo Grande, California. Serving over 90,000 patients annually, the hospital offers a full complement of services including, emergency care, and orthopedics. Additionally, Arroyo Grande Community Hospital has been recognized as an LGBTQ+ Healthcare Equality High Performer by the Human Rights Campaign Foundation. It is a Joint Commission-certified Primary Stroke Center, and has the only inpatient Acute Rehabilitation Center between Salinas and Santa Barbara.

Job Summary and Responsibilities

As our Phlebotomist, you will obtaining blood, urine, and culture specimens from patients ranging in age from newborn to geriatric, according to established procedures of Arroyo Grande Community Hospital and State and Federal Regulations. Performs clerical functions and routine repetitive specimen testing under direct supervision of a licensed technologist.

 

Every day you will perform clerical functions and routine repetitive specimen testing under direct supervision of a licensed technologist.

 

To be successful in this role, you must must be able to properly handle patient specimens as to the guidelines specified in the phlebotomy manual and our reference manuals.

 

Job Requirements

Required

  • State of California Phlebotomy Certificate (CT PHLEBOT)
  • Current and valide CPR-AHA certification (CT CPRBLS)
